Key Elements of a Blank Resignation Letter Template Word for Career Change
A good blank resignation letter template word for career change should include the following elements:
| Element | Description |
|---|---|
| Introduction | Formal greeting and statement of intention to resign |
| Notice Period | Specify the notice period and date of last day of work |
| Reason for Leaving | Optional: provide a brief explanation for leaving (e.g., career change) |
| Offer to Assist | Express willingness to help with the transition |
| Closing | Professional closing and signature |

Example 2: Detailed Template
[Your Name]
[Your Address]
[City, State ZIP Code]
[Date]
[Recipient’s Name]
[Recipient’s Title]
[Company Name]
[Company Address]
[City, State ZIP Code]
Dear [Recipient’s Name],
I am writing to inform you of my decision to resign from my position as [Your Position] at [Company Name], effective [Date of Last Day of Work].
Over the past [X] years, I have gained valuable experience and skills that have prepared me for a new career challenge. I am excited to leverage my expertise in a new field and contribute to a different organization.
I want to thank you for the opportunities I have had while working at [Company Name]. I appreciate the support and guidance you have provided during my tenure.
Please let me know how I can assist with the transition and complete any outstanding tasks.
Thank you again for your understanding, and I wish the company continued success.
Sincerely,
[Your Signature]
[Your Name]

Tips for Writing a Resignation Letter for a Career Change
When writing a blank resignation letter template word for career change, keep the following tips in mind:
- Be clear and direct about your intention to resign
- Provide sufficient notice (usually 2 weeks)
- Keep the tone professional and positive
- Proofread carefully to avoid errors
- Include your contact information for future reference
